Erasmus+ mobility programs are EU-funded knowledge exchange and training courses that offer local youths, youth workers, and educators opportunities to travel, learn, grow and network. These programs include international exchanges, volunteering, and professional development, fully funded to remove financial barriers. Eligibility varies but typically includes young people aged 18–30, youth workers and educators have no age limit. No prior experience is needed, and programs welcome diverse backgrounds. Some require enrollment in a school or organization. Reach out for eligibility details!
Erasmus+ mobility programs cover travel, accommodation, and program fees, making them fully funded youth mobility opportunities. Participants may need to cover personal expenses. Our NGO offers low-cost support, unlike agencies charging $1,000–$3,000. For more information contact us!

Preparation is key to a successful mobility experience! We recommend focusing on a few areas:
-Carefully read the program’s infopack and all related materials before applying. Ensure you understand every communication email or message you receive from the organizers.
– Ensure your passport or other travel document is valid for the entire duration of your stay +6 months and gather any necessary personal documents well in advance.
Finances: Even for funded programs, plan for personal expenses, travel insurance, and any initial costs.
Health: Consult your doctor about any necessary vaccinations or medications.
Communication & Common Sense: Always ask questions to us or the organizer if something is not clear. Use common sense and be mindful of your surroundings and local customs.
Mindset: Be open to new experiences, challenges, and cultural differences. Embrace the opportunity for personal and professional growth!
